中海支付API开发指南1.01:商户角色与接口详解

需积分: 0 0 下载量 83 浏览量 更新于2024-08-04 收藏 44KB DOCX 举报
中海支付API文档1.01主要涵盖了商户在集成中海支付服务时所需的关键信息。这份文档针对的是技术背景下的商户,包括技术架构师、研发工程师、测试工程师和系统运维工程师,旨在帮助他们理解并实现在线支付功能。 首先,文档明确了支付角色定位,即商家、买家和中间服务方(如中海支付)在交易过程中的作用。商家负责商品或服务的提供,买家则是消费者,而中海支付作为支付中介,提供了支付接口和订单查询接口,使得交易过程更加便捷。商家需在自己的网站上集成这些接口,以便买家能顺利完成支付。 在接口开发部分,文档详细解释了接入流程。商户需要申请中海支付的账户,获得支付网关权限和必要的设置,如手续费和结算周期。获取的key是用于后续数据签名的重要密钥,商户需妥善保管。支付实现流程包括:构建请求数据,这涉及到遵循接口规则生成签名;发送请求,通常通过页面跳转或表单提交;中海支付接收数据后进行安全验证,通过后处理请求;最后,商户会接收到中海支付的响应结果。 数据交互部分,文档介绍了两种关键类型:页面跳转交互,即用户在商户网站上的支付操作;服务器通知交互,当支付状态发生改变时,中海支付会向商户的服务器发送通知。这两种交互对于实时更新交易状态至关重要。 文档还涵盖了数据格式、数字签名的具体规则,以及支付接口和订单查询接口的业务功能、请求参数列表和返回值。支付接口用于处理实际的支付请求,如业务处理、参数验证和结果反馈,而订单查询接口则用来查询订单状态。 在整个文档中,安全性和合规性是核心关注点,包括如何正确地使用数字签名确保数据的安全传输和防止欺诈。此外,对于测试和运维工程师,文档可能会强调接口的测试方法、错误处理机制以及如何在生产环境中稳定运行和维护这些接口。 中海支付API文档1.01是一份全面的指南,为商户提供了一套完整的集成方案,从角色定位到接口操作,再到数据交互和安全措施,确保商户能够顺利实现在线支付功能,并有效管理其与中海支付系统的交互。